About the role

We are seeking a full-time Senior Interior Designer for our Kansas City studio location. This role involves leading project design, interiors team management, and client communication. You will also lead client presentations and serve as the main point of contact for clients on interiors projects.

Responsibilities

  • Lead and mentor junior associates to develop innovative design concepts for projects that are client-focused, functional and aesthetic.
  • Manage interiors projects and teams, including client communications, timelines and budgets.
  • Lead client presentations and serve as the main point of contact for clients on interiors projects, maintaining strong relationships.
  • Elevate knowledge of innovative materials and applications, integrating sustainable and energy efficient strategies.
  • Oversee the production and execution of high quality construction documents and detailed drawings by conducting thorough quality control checks throughout the project.
  • Cook up with contractors, architects, and engineers to ensure that the design is executed and deadlines are met.
  • Support business development through networking and client acquisition, contributing to proposal development and RFP responses.

Requirements

  • Professional degree in Interior Design, Architecture, or Interior Architecture.
  • Certification as licensed professional, preferred NCIDQ.
  • Minimum of 10 years’ interiors related experience.
